H.R. No. 103


R E S O L U T I O N
WHEREAS, Midland residents Lloyd and Ruth Thomas celebrated the joyous occasion of their 60th wedding anniversary on February 7, 2006; and WHEREAS, United in matrimony in Oakland, California, in 1946, Mr. Thomas and the former Ruth Lesley lived in Big Spring before moving to Midland 10 years ago; over the course of their marriage, they have been blessed with four children, five grandchildren, and two great-grandchildren; and WHEREAS, The Thomases have led busy and productive lives during the past six decades; in addition to raising their family, Mrs. Thomas has been a dedicated homemaker throughout the marriage while Mr. Thomas worked for Fina/Cosden Pipeline for 29 years before retiring in 1983; today, the couple remain valued members of Fairmont Park Church of Christ; and WHEREAS, The enduring union of Lloyd and Ruth Thomas offers eloquent testimony to the meaning of love and commitment, and their marriage is a genuine inspiration to all those who share in the richness of their lives; now, therefore, be it RESOLVED, That the House of Representatives of the 79th Texas Legislature, 3rd Called Session, hereby congratulate Lloyd and Ruth Thomas on the milestone of their 60th wedding anniversary and extend to them heartfelt best wishes for the future; and, be it further RESOLVED, That an official copy of this resolution be prepared for Mr. and Mrs. Thomas as an expression of high regard by the Texas House of Representatives.
